How to Host WordPress on VPS
Are you looking to take your WordPress website to the next level in terms of performance and customization? Hosting your WordPress site on a Virtual Private Server (VPS) might just be the solution you’re looking for. In this article, we will guide you through the process of hosting WordPress on a VPS, from selecting a hosting provider to setting up your server and installing WordPress.
Why Host WordPress on a VPS?
Hosting your WordPress site on a VPS offers several advantages over traditional shared hosting. With a VPS, you have more control over your server environment, allowing you to customize it to suit your specific needs. You also have access to more resources, such as CPU, RAM, and storage, which can improve the performance of your site. Additionally, hosting on a VPS gives you the flexibility to install custom software and configure your server to optimize WordPress.
Choosing a VPS Hosting Provider
When selecting a VPS hosting provider, there are several factors to consider. Some key considerations include:
- Server specifications: Ensure that the VPS meets the minimum requirements for hosting WordPress, such as the amount of RAM, storage space, and bandwidth.
- Performance: Look for a hosting provider that offers fast and reliable servers to ensure optimal performance for your WordPress site.
- Scalability: Choose a hosting provider that allows you to easily upgrade your VPS as your site grows.
- Customer support: Consider the level of customer support provided by the hosting provider, as you may need assistance with server setup and maintenance.
Some popular VPS hosting providers for hosting WordPress include DigitalOcean, Linode, and Vultr. These providers offer affordable VPS plans with a range of features to meet your hosting needs.
Setting Up Your VPS
Once you have selected a VPS hosting provider, the next step is to set up your server. This involves creating a new VPS instance, configuring the server settings, and securing your server. Most hosting providers offer easy-to-follow guides for setting up a VPS, so be sure to consult their documentation for detailed instructions.
Installing WordPress on Your VPS
After setting up your VPS, you can proceed to install WordPress on your server. There are several ways to do this, including using a one-click installer provided by your hosting provider or manually installing WordPress by uploading the files to your server. For detailed instructions on installing WordPress on a VPS, refer to the official WordPress documentation.
Optimizing Your WordPress Site on a VPS
Once WordPress is installed on your VPS, you can optimize your site for better performance and security. Some optimization tips include:
- Use a caching plugin to improve site speed.
- Optimize images to reduce load times.
- Enable SSL to secure your site and improve SEO rankings.
- Regularly update WordPress, themes, and plugins to ensure security.
- Monitor site performance and make adjustments as needed.
By hosting WordPress on a VPS and optimizing your site, you can take your website to the next level in terms of performance, customization, and security. With the right hosting provider and proper server setup, you can create a fast, secure, and flexible WordPress site that meets your unique needs.
Are you ready to host WordPress on a VPS? Take the next step towards enhancing your website today!